Journal of Undergraduate International Studies Call for Submissions and Editors

The Journal of Undergraduate International Studies (JUIS) at the University of Wisconsin-Madison is currently accepting submissions for its Spring 2014 issue. The journal seeks to publish the best undergraduate work across the country related to international themes and topics including, but not limited to: international conflict and conflict resolution, human rights, environmental issues, culture, history, comparative politics and economics, development and trade, global security and international health.

JUIS is currently accepting submissions of written work or photographs. JUIS is also currently recruiting editors and a layout designer for the Spring 2014 semester. Our written submissions generally range in length from 5-20 pages. Submissions must not have been published in any other publication. Current undergraduates and recent graduates (one semester out or less) are eligible to submit their work.
